Finance Ministry and Local Government officials will make a last-minute attempt tomorrow night to avert a municipal workers\' nationwide strike. The strike, if held, will include garbage collectors, and is planned to begin on Sunday - a week before the week-long Passover holiday. The dispute is a remnant of the strike of two months ago, when newly-elected Prime Minister Sharon promised that the national government would pay half the pay raise promised the city workers. The Finance Ministry would like to \"re-negotiate\" that promise. The strike also threatens Jerusalem, even though Mayor Ehud Olmert has agreed to pay a higher proportion of the pay raise. Olmert says that uncollected piles of refuse could pose a security threat.
